I've been replaying the original Spyro trilogy lately and the games are still a lotta fun and very charming. I also find that they can be a bit too pathetically easy. Because of that it's so bizarre to me when I see people complaining about certain parts being too frustrating because I tend to like those same parts because they actually provide some challenge.

Anyway a big one that comes to mind is that second to last level in Ratchet and Clank Going Commando. You know the one with all the pets. I enjoy that level lol.

i remember there being complaints about crash bandicoot running from boulder levels
i recall people saying they were poorly designed and unfair due to not being able to see the obstacles in front of you since you were running towards the screen, but i remember thinking they were the most fun levels in the game
